SAINT SKIN

13m

Saint Skin, a film written and directed by Ricardo Flores, is an experimental short inspired by a collection of poetry written by Flores. As a thesis film for his studies at Santa Monica College. The film explores masculinity, desire, morality, spirituality, and the body as a site of both violence and liberation. Through fragmented images, memory, ritual, and movement, Saint Skin follows a young artist confronting the forces that have taught him how to inhabit his own skin—and his attempt to reclaim it as something sacred.
